相关推荐
-
wu反走样算法的实现
c实现的wu反走样算法,编译可运行,是一种很好的反走样反锯齿算法,Michael Abrash强烈推荐的算法
-
计算机图形学笔记 || 基本图形的扫描转换
系统介绍直线和圆的扫描转换算法原理,代码片段;简单说明反走样算法原理。
-
计算机图形学的反走样
1.二维光栅图形走样表现有三种: (1)呈现阶梯状失真 (2)图形的细节失真 一些狭长多边形由于没有覆盖像素中心所以不被绘制,很多细节无法显示 (3)狭小图形遗失以及造成的运动图形的闪烁 一个狭长图形向右运动,当图形覆盖像素中心时,它可以被完整绘制,否则就无法显示,造成图形在运动过程中时隐时现,无法正常显示。 2.反走样技术(分为硬件和软件) (1)硬件数据:提高分辨率,对硬件要求高,代价较大 (2)软件技术:改进软件算法 加权区域采样:利用人眼视觉特性,通过加权平均的方法,调节像素的亮度等级以产.
-
WU反走样算法
由离散量表示连续量而引起的失真称为走样,用于减轻走样现象的技术成为反走样,游戏中称为抗锯齿。走样是连续图形离散为想想点后引起的失真,真实像素面积不为 零。走样是光栅扫描显示器的一种固有现象,只能减轻,不可避免。空间混色原理指出,人眼对某一区域颜色的识别是取这个区域颜色的平均值,Wu 反走样算法原理是对理想直线上的任一点,同时用两个不同亮度等级的相邻像素来表示。Wu 反走样算法是对距离进行加权的反走样算法。
-
基于EasyX使用Wu反走样算法画线
运用easyx消除锯齿,实现反走样
-
C++ Wu直线反走样实现代码
C++ Wu直线反走样实现代码 这是从国外一个论坛上下载下来的实现Wu直线生成反走样算法的源代码。用VC++6.0实现的,看着还是比较经典的。国内一些论坛只把核心代码贴了出来,没有把所有代码都写上。这里上传的是非常完整的。 若侵犯了作者版权,请联系我。另,此代码仅供学习研究用,若应用于商业用途,请联系作者。 Wu反直样 直线生成 VC++6.0 代码
-
WU反走样(Anti-aliased)直线初探(转)
WU反走样(Anti-aliased)直线初探(转)[@more@] 普通的Breshenham算法画线很快,但并不是很精细.通常的整数画线因为只能在整数坐标上绘图,所以产生难看的锯齿.我在Michael Abrash的一本书...
-
08-第一个八分象限直线的Wu反走样算法
08-第一个八分象限直线的Wu反走样算法
-
实验十二 反走样
绘制两条线段,其中一条不加反走样处理,另一条不加反走样处理。
-
反走样技术
直线扫描转换算法在处理非水平、非垂直且非45°的直线段时会出现锯齿,这是因为直线段在光栅扫描显示器上显示的图像是由一系列亮度相同而面积不为零的离散像素点构成的。这种由离散量表示连续量而引起的失真称为走样(aliasing)。用于减轻走样现象的技术称为反走样(anti-aliasing,AA)或者抗锯齿。走样是理想直线(理想直线宽度为零)扫描转换后(真实像素点面积不为零)的必然结果。走样是光栅扫描显...
-
android 屏幕中心坐标原点,Android 的坐标系及矩阵变换
8种机械键盘轴体对比本人程序员,要买一个写代码的键盘,请问红轴和茶轴怎么选?Android的坐标系2D坐标系android的2d坐标系如图所示,水平向右为X轴正方向,竖直向下为Y轴正方向,原点为屏幕左上角。注意:以屏幕左上角为原点的坐标系,称作绝对坐标系,将原点平移到View的左上角,称作相对坐标系。对View进行操作时,更多使用的是相对坐标系。3D坐标系左手坐标系在计算机科学中,大多3D坐标系...
-
wu反走样(Anti-aliased)直线 (转)
wu反走样(Anti-aliased)直线 (转)[@more@]可能有图片或者下载的链接不对,请到原始地址查看.http://dgame.yeah.NET ==================================...
-
Wu直线反走样实现代码
这是从国外一个论坛上下载下来的实现Wu直线生成反走样算法的源代码。用VC++6.0实现的,看着还是比较经典的。国内一些论坛只把核心代码贴了出来,没有把所有代码都写上。这里上传的是非常完整的。 若侵犯了作者版权,请联系我。另,此代码仅供学习研究用,若应用于商业用途,请联系作者。
-
直线的反走样算法
直线的反走样算法比较简单,不做详细介绍. 需要说明的是这个算法原理我不是原创,经典书籍上都有记载,其中反走样算法都是斜率在0-1之间的直线的算法,我还真没见过完整的.所以我这里把它补充完整了,算法效率毋庸置疑,几乎不可能再快了. 第一个函数是画线的经典函数,第二个是反走样直线的算法.和画直线算法相比较,增加的部分用 ///+ 标明了.#define WCG_FILTER(d) ((d)>1.4142136?0:((d)
-
计算机图形直线分析,计算机图形学 直线反走样Wu算法(4)
计算机图形学 直线反走样Wu算法(4)来源:互联网 作者:佚名 时间:2015-03-21 22:12本文通过一个完整的实例来演示,直线反走样Wu算法。作者:卿笃军
-
OpenGL 之顶点vertex
简述: “点”是一切的基础。OpenGL提供了一系列函数glVertex* 指定一个点。OpenGL要求,指定顶点的命令必须包含在glBegin 函数之后,glEnd 函数之前,并由glBegin来指明如何使用这些点。OpenGL的默认坐标值从-1 到1 。 1、点、直线和多边形 ① 数学(或者具体的说,是几何学)中有点、直线和多边形的概念,但与计算机中的概念会有所不同。 ② 数学上的点,只有位置,没有大小。但在计算机中,无论计算精度如何提高,始终不能表示一个无穷小的点。另一方面,无论图形输出
-
计算机图形学学习笔记(4.4):图元与反走样
图元属性 基本图元属性: 点: 颜色、大小(像素方块) 直线:颜色、线宽、线型 附加技能:画笔、笔刷等特殊效果 线宽 - 斜率绝对值<1 交替的在单宽度路径上下绘制像素 显示的线宽根据,实际线宽和斜率计算 线帽 - 减少端点的影响 折线转折 - 斜角连接 - 延伸外边界 -角度过小时会转换为斜切 - 圆连接 - 用直径等于线宽的圆进行表示 - 斜切连接 - 方帽并填充三角形间隙 ...
1 楼 hantsy 2009-05-12 17:05
其实应该集成到 Gnome 桌面的文件共享(提供统一的api,不同服务提供商可以提供自己的实现)功能中去。